UTSTYR NORD AS is registered as a limited company in Alstahaug, Nordland with organisation number 930768235. The business is classified under rental and leasing of construction and civil engineering machinery and equipment (NACE 77.320). The company was incorporated in 2022. Registered share capital is NOK 30,000, divided into 30 shares. The company's stated purpose is: “Utleie av maskiner, utstyr og andre produkter som naturlig faller sammen med dette, herunder å delta i andre selskaper med lignende virksomhet, kjøp og salg av aksjer.”. The most recent filed accounts, for the 2024 financial year, show NOK 343,000 in revenue and NOK −108,000 in operating profit.
